The Mysteries of Sherlock Holmes by Arthur Conan Doyle, Kwame Alexander, Margaret Dilloway


This has three Holmes mysteries that are written for young ones.  I enjoyed reading them.  The characters are both women and, of course, Holmes is the one who solves most of the mysteries.

Sourcebooks Wonderland and Edelweiss allowed me to read this book for review (thank you).  It will be published on November 3rd.

There are activities at the back of the book that will help a child learn to be a detective.

The stories are good and the activities look like fun.  Your children should have fun with this, give it a try.
